Diving Deep: What Powers the Quantum Edge 3 Stretto Battery?

Okay, so we know it's important. But what kind of magic is actually happening inside that battery casing? Most power wheelchairs like the Stretto typically utilize deep-cycle batteries, which are different from car batteries. Car batteries deliver a quick burst of high power to start an engine, but deep-cycle batteries are designed to provide a steady amount of power over a long period, discharging deeply and recharging many times.

You'll usually find two main types when it comes to the Quantum Edge 3 Stretto battery: * AGM (Absorbent Glass Mat) or Gel Cell Batteries: These are the most common choices. They're sealed, maintenance-free (no need to add water!), and spill-proof, which is a huge plus for safety and convenience. AGM batteries generally offer a good balance of performance and longevity, while Gel cells are often preferred for their even deeper discharge capabilities and resistance to extreme temperatures, though they might have a slightly lower peak power output. * Lithium-Ion Batteries (often an upgrade): Increasingly, manufacturers are offering lithium-ion battery options. These are lighter, offer a longer range, charge faster, and often have a longer lifespan overall. If you've ever felt the difference between a traditional laptop and a modern ultrabook, you'll appreciate the leap in energy density. While they might come with a higher upfront cost, the benefits in terms of weight, performance, and charging convenience can be pretty significant for a power wheelchair user.

No matter the chemistry, we're typically talking about a 24-volt system (made up of two 12-volt batteries wired in series) with a significant Amp-hour (Ah) rating. This Ah rating is your key indicator of how much "fuel" is in the tank. A higher Ah rating generally means a longer range and more time between charges. For a chair like the Stretto, you're usually looking at something in the 50-75 Ah range or higher, providing enough juice for an impressive range – often 10-20 miles or more, depending on terrain, user weight, and driving style. Keeping Your Power Alive: Maintenance and Best Practices

Having a fantastic quantum edge 3 stretto battery is one thing; keeping it in top shape is another. Just like any crucial piece of tech, a little TLC goes a long way in maximizing its lifespan and ensuring consistent performance. You wouldn't run your car on fumes all the time, right? The same principle applies here.

Here are a few friendly tips:

  • Charge Regularly: This is probably the most important one. Try to get into the habit of charging your battery every night, even if you haven't fully depleted it. Deep-cycle batteries actually prefer being topped off rather than being run down to zero repeatedly.
  • Avoid Deep Discharges: While these batteries are designed for deep discharge, constantly running them until they're completely dead significantly shortens their lifespan. Aim to recharge when the battery indicator shows around 20-25% remaining, if possible.
  • Use the Right Charger: Always, always use the charger supplied with your Quantum Edge 3 Stretto, or a direct, approved replacement. Using an incompatible charger can damage the battery, reduce its lifespan, or even pose a safety risk.
  • Proper Storage: If you're going to store your chair for an extended period (like a vacation), ensure the battery is fully charged, and ideally, top it off once a month. Store it in a cool, dry place. Extreme heat or cold can degrade battery performance.
  • Keep it Clean: Occasionally check the battery terminals (if accessible) to ensure they're clean and free of corrosion. A good connection means efficient power transfer.

You'll know your battery might be starting to show its age if you notice a significant decrease in range, slower acceleration, or if it takes much longer to charge than usual. When that happens, it's a good idea to consult with a qualified technician or your mobility dealer. Replacing a battery isn't usually complicated, but getting the right type and ensuring it's installed correctly is key.
